    Black Mountain Dude Ranch is located in the heart of the Rocky Mountains of Colorado. Join us for a week long stay at our family run, full service working guest and cattle ranch. Activities include: unlimited horseback riding, longhorn cattle drive, white water rafting, overnight pack camp, skeet & trap shooting, fly & spin fishing, cattle clinics, western dancing, stand-up paddle boarding, canoeing... or you can just take it easy in one of our hot tubs!

      Black Mountain Ranch is about as close to heaven on earth as one can get for a local weekend trip.

      BMR is a family ran and owned ranch located in McCoy, Colorado about halfway between Steamboat Springs and Vail so as you can imagine the views are breathtaking in every direction. There are no main highways or road near the ranch so it is so quiet you can hear a pin drop.

      So what can you do at BMR? You could spend your weekend horseback riding, hiking, trap shooting, white water rafting, fly fishing, or learning to round up cattle and BMR has a knowledgeable and helpful staff to assist you in everyway possible. But if you desire a more relaxing weekend you could sit back and read a book or pet the obnoxiously adorable baby goats or the donkeys.

      The Black Mountain Ranch provides three meals per day, they have a salon, a pool, hot tubs, and boots / chaps for you to utilize during your stay.

      Really your time spent there will be relaxing and amazing no matter what you choose to do.

      What an amazing vacation! My (new) husband and I chose Black Mountain Ranch for our honeymoon. It might seem a bit crazy to spend your honeymoon on a Dude Ranch but it was exactly what we were looking for and I can't recommend it enough!

      During our week on the Ranch we met families and independent travelers - the Ranch can handle any group of travelers, all you have to do is bring your adventurous spirit.

      The staff are so warm and truly lovely. They are great with kids, great with adults who are kids at heart and great with adjusting city folks to life on a working cattle ranch.

      The setting could not be more stunning. Every day you're surrounded by horses and landscapes as far as the eye can see. Your daily schedule is really up to you! Trail riding, arena riding, a trip to the shooting range, learning to rope, playing horseshoes, shooting pool, take a swim in the pool, go rafting, fishing, canoeing...see what I mean!

      One night dinner is served at the lake, you ride there and back. One night everyone sleeps out at Pack Camp, and you ride back the next day. You pick the difficulty of your ride (easy, medium, hard) and once you arrive at Pack Camp your tent is set up and hot food is waiting for you. Plus campfire songs and the most beautiful night sky and stars you could ever imagine.

      The food is so delicious with lots of options for your whole family. Breakfast and lunch are buffet-style and most days you order breakfast at dinner from a few options. Plus endless cookies on hand fresh-baked daily.

      I love vacations like this - limited decisions! All you have to do is pick a few things every day and the rest is taken care of.

      Your wrangler is your guide for the week but anyone on the property will help you with questions and everyone has skills they're really great at and willing to share their tips and tricks from practicing roping to learning to Texas 2-step in the saloon in the evenings. Kids included!

      Your horse is your best friend for the week. You'll be shocked at how much more comfortable you feel on a hose by the end of the week. This goes for both experienced and non-experienced riders.

      Not having a cell phone was a blessing and we didn't miss it one bit. What a treat to really be on vacation and not be attached to your phone. There is limited wifi, but we didn't use it and didn't miss that either. There are of course phones on the property and ways to check back in with work/family if you have to.

      Towards the end of the week, I mentioned to some of the families that I was surprised not to see one single kid meltdown or anyone not smiling all the time - the parents all agreed that since there were endless options and activities the kids were always occupied and that left everyone happy and tired at the end of the day. Same goes for adults!

      As for us, it was a really romantic trip. We had tons of time to spend alone in the wilderness but also time to get to know some really cool families and some amazing staff, cowboys, cowgirls and wranglers.

      Thank you to the May Family at Black Mountain Ranch for over 20 years of service. It was absolutely a vacation we'll never forget and will be telling friends about for years and years to come.

      Amazing experience. Black Mountain Ranch is run by a friendly, caring family and staff, and do everything they can to make your time at the ranch a wonderful experience.

      Beautiful setting for a range of adventures: horseback riding (on trails in the mountains or in the arena for barrel racing, etc.), trap shooting, lassoing calfs, cattle driving (on Saturdays), hiking, whitewater rafting, fishing, swimming, hot tubbing, and more. The setting is great, but it's the people that make it a great experience.

      When you arrive, you meet your wrangler for the week, meet your horse, and start to outline your week. Your schedule is up to you: while there are some activities scheduled throughout the week (whitewater rafting, camping out one night, dinner rides into the mountains, cattle driving), you have the opportunity to create your own schedule. Want to relax, nap, read, hot tub? Go ahead. Want to go ride your horse hours into the mountains? Your wrangler will help make it happen.

      Every day starts with a great breakfast, and every day ends with a great dinner. And on most nights, dancing, drinking, and playing pool with the cowboys at the saloon on the ranch.

      In short: go.
